Skip to main content

Command Palette

Search for a command to run...

SMTP Server Monitoring: Tools and Techniques to Avoid Downtime

Published
5 min read

Introduction

In today’s fast-paced digital world, businesses rely heavily on email communication. Whether it’s sending transactional emails, marketing newsletters, or simple internal communication, having a reliable SMTP (Simple Mail Transfer Protocol) server is essential. However, when an SMTP server faces issues, email deliverability can be severely affected, leading to missed opportunities and frustrated customers. This is where SMTP server monitoring comes into play.

In this blog, we'll dive into the importance of SMTP server monitoring, explore the tools you can use to check SMTP server performance, and offer techniques to help avoid downtime. Additionally, we’ll explain how running regular SMTP server tests can ensure your email infrastructure remains robust and dependable.

Why SMTP Server Monitoring Matters?

The SMTP server is the backbone of your email system. Any glitch in its functioning can lead to significant consequences, including:

  • Delayed emails or emails not reaching their intended recipients.

  • Emails landing in spam folders, reducing deliverability.

  • Failure in delivering transactional emails, such as order confirmations or password resets.

  • Reputation damage to your IP due to undelivered or bounced emails.

To mitigate these risks, proactive mail server checks and ongoing monitoring are crucial. Monitoring helps detect issues early, allowing you to address them before they cause noticeable disruptions. It ensures that your SMTP server maintains optimal performance, improving your email deliverability and communication efficiency.

Essential Tools for SMTP Server Monitoring

Now that you understand the importance of SMTP server monitoring, let's explore some effective tools that can help you check your SMTP server performance and avoid costly downtimes.

1. SMTP Server Test Tools

SMTP server test tools are designed to help you analyze and troubleshoot your server's functionality. They allow you to simulate sending an email through your SMTP server and identify potential errors or delays. These tools can help verify if the server is capable of sending and receiving emails without any issues.

  • MxToolbox SMTP Diagnostics: This tool provides a comprehensive SMTP test online, analyzing mail flow and identifying potential issues.

  • SMTPTester: A simple open-source tool that helps you run SMTP mail server checks and see how your server handles sending emails.

  • SendForensics: A diagnostic tool that performs a deep analysis of your email infrastructure to detect deliverability issues.

2. SMTP Test Online Platforms

Many platforms offer SMTP tests online that provide a quick and easy way to assess your server's performance. These tools generally require only basic information, such as your domain name and server details, and they will run a series of tests to evaluate the server’s health.

  • SSL-Tools SMTP Check: This tool checks the configuration of your mail server, including SSL and TLS certificates, ensuring secure email delivery.

  • Mail-tester.com: It provides a detailed report of your email's journey through your SMTP server and highlights any spammy elements that could hinder deliverability.

3. Mail Server Check Solutions

In addition to running SMTP server tests, you can use more advanced tools to perform thorough mail server checks. These solutions go beyond basic diagnostics and offer real-time monitoring, alerting you to any critical issues that might arise with your server.

Key Mail Server Check Tools:

  • Zabbix: An open-source monitoring solution that tracks server performance, including SMTP servers. It provides detailed logs and real-time alerts to keep your server running smoothly.

  • Nagios: Known for its reliability, Nagios monitors your entire network infrastructure and sends notifications if any SMTP issues are detected.

  • SolarWinds Server & Application Monitor: This powerful tool offers detailed insights into the health of your mail servers, including their performance metrics and potential bottlenecks.

Techniques to Avoid SMTP Server Downtime

Knowing how to maintain and optimise your email server testing tool can go a long way in preventing downtime. Here are some effective techniques to ensure your SMTP server remains operational and efficient.

1. Regular Testing

Conducting regular SMTP server tests is one of the simplest ways to avoid server downtime. Schedule daily or weekly SMTP test online checks to ensure your mail server is performing optimally. This can help you identify any issues early and prevent larger problems from arising.

2. Monitor Server Logs

SMTP server logs provide a detailed history of the server’s activity, including errors and warnings. By monitoring these logs, you can identify patterns or recurring issues that may lead to server failure. Many SMTP monitoring tools can automate this process, sending alerts when abnormal activity is detected.

3. Keep Software Updated

Outdated server software can leave you vulnerable to security threats and bugs that may lead to downtime. Regularly updating your SMTP server software ensures that it is running with the latest security patches and optimizations. Many monitoring tools, like Nagios and Zabbix, provide reminders for updates and maintenance tasks.

4. Set Up Alerts and Notifications

Proactive monitoring involves setting up real-time alerts that notify you when your SMTP server is experiencing issues. These alerts can be configured to trigger various performance metrics, such as server response time, error rate, or failed email deliveries. Tools like SolarWinds and Nagios allow you to customise these alerts based on your specific needs.

5. Backup and Redundancy

In case of unexpected SMTP server failure, having a backup server or redundant system can minimise downtime. You can configure an alternate SMTP server to take over if the primary one goes down. This ensures continuous email delivery and communication without interruptions.

Conclusion

SMTP server monitoring is a critical aspect of maintaining smooth and reliable email communication. With the right tools and techniques, you can proactively check SMTP server performance, run regular mail server checks, and conduct SMTP server tests to avoid unexpected downtimes. Utilizing SMTP test online platforms can help you monitor and troubleshoot issues in real time, improving your overall email deliverability.

By implementing these strategies and maintaining a robust server monitoring system, you can ensure that your SMTP server remains efficient, secure, and always ready to meet your business’s communication needs.